酚类是一大类化合物,它们主要特征是分子中含有一个羟基(-OH)直接连接在苯环上。这类化合物广泛存在于自然界中,并且具有重要的生物、医药及工业应用价值。

尽管酚类化合物具有广泛的应用前景,但它们也可能带来毒性问题。例如强酸性的酚类物质会对皮肤造成刺激甚至腐蚀。因此在使用时需注意安全防护措施。
